The ingredients needed to make Sauvignon Cocoa:
  1. Prepare 1 kg minute roast (meat)
  2. Get 20 oz Sauvignon blanc (white wine)
  3. Get 2 table spoons of fine cocoa powder (unsweetened)
  4. Get salt

Instructions to make Sauvignon Cocoa:
  1. First mix the wine and cocoa and cook/simmer for 25-30 mins
  2. Cool the wine cocoa, and add it to a bag with the meat
  3. Marinate for 24 hours in fridge
  4. Put the meat in a pan and salt it
  5. Bake in the oven (covered) at 450 for 1hr for medium rare
